This photograph, titled "Trans-Mississippi Exposition, Grand Court, Mississippi i.e. Omaha, Neb. c1898," is a stunning hand-colored panorama capturing the grandeur and excitement of the Trans-Mississippi Exposition held in Omaha, Nebraska, United States of America, during the late 19th century. Taken by renowned photographer William H. Jackson, this image offers a unique perspective of the exposition's Grand Court, located in Kountze Park along Pinkney Street. The Grand Court, a magnificent building with intricate architectural details, stands proudly at the heart of the exposition, surrounded by a bustling crowd of attendees. The lake in the foreground adds a serene contrast to the urban scene, while the vibrant colors and hand-tinted details bring the image to life. The Trans-Mississippi Exposition was a significant event in American history, showcasing the progress and achievements of the western United States. This photograph, taken by Jackson for Detroit Publishing Company, provides a valuable glimpse into the past, offering insight into the country's rich heritage and the spirit of exploration and innovation that defined the era. The Library of Congress, in its vast collection, preserves this historical treasure, ensuring that future generations can appreciate the beauty and significance of this moment in time.
